技术文摘
怎样理解xyz判断点在凸包内的模板
2025-01-15 03:29:02 小编
怎样理解xyz判断点在凸包内的模板
在计算机几何领域,判断一个点是否在凸包内是一个常见且重要的问题。xyz判断点在凸包内的模板为我们提供了一种有效的解决方案,深入理解它对于解决相关几何问题至关重要。
我们要明白凸包的概念。凸包就像是一个包裹着一系列点的最小凸多边形,所有这些点都在凸包内部或者边界上。而判断点是否在凸包内,就是确定给定的点是否被这个“包裹”所包含。
xyz模板的核心在于通过特定的计算逻辑来实现这一判断。它通常基于向量运算和几何性质。比如利用向量的叉积来判断点与凸包边界的位置关系。当我们从凸包的一个顶点出发,沿着边界遍历,通过计算待判断点与相邻顶点构成的向量叉积,就可以得知该点相对于凸包边界的位置。
从算法流程来看,xyz模板会先对凸包的顶点进行有序处理。这是因为有序的顶点能够让我们按照一定的方向进行遍历和计算,确保判断的准确性。然后,针对每个顶点及其相邻顶点,构建向量并与待判断点进行运算。如果在整个遍历过程中,点相对于所有边界向量的位置都满足在凸包内部的条件,那么就可以判定该点在凸包内。
理解xyz模板的优势也很关键。它具有较高的准确性和稳定性,经过大量实践验证,能够在多种复杂情况下正确判断点的位置。而且,其计算效率相对较高,对于大规模数据的处理也能在可接受的时间内完成。
在实际应用中,无论是地理信息系统中判断某个地点是否在特定区域内,还是图形处理中判断一个像素是否在某个形状内部,xyz判断点在凸包内的模板都发挥着重要作用。通过深入理解这个模板,我们可以更好地运用它解决实际问题,提升相关算法的性能和可靠性。
- Win10 电脑磁盘加密的解除方法及硬盘加密取消设置步骤
- Win10 无法清空回收站的七种解决策略
- Win10 无法设置移动热点的解决之道
- Win10 扬声器无增强选项的应对策略
- Win10 系统 antimalware 的关闭方法及禁用教程
- Win10 英特尔驱动与硬件无法启动及 wifi6 ax201 160MHz 报错解决办法
- Win10 安全模式跳过开机密码的办法
- Win10 处理器数量设置方法:提升电脑运行速度秘籍
- Win10 安全模式中修复系统文件的方法
- Win10 安全模式在 Dell 电脑上进不去的解决办法
- Win10 卸载软件残留的清理方法
- Win10 主题图片的存放位置及查找办法
- Win10 21H2 Build 19044.2132(KB5020435)OOB 更新发布及完整更新日志
- Win10 系统组织管理更新策略提示的解决之道
- Win10 22H2 未推送的解决之道